The DF5A5.6CFU is a Transient Voltage Suppressor (TVS) diode manufactured by Toshiba Semiconductor and Storage. It's engineered to safeguard sensitive electronic circuits from voltage spikes caused by electrostatic discharge (ESD), inductive switching, and other transient voltage phenomena. Its compact form factor and dependable performance make it well-suited for diverse protection applications.

Technical Specifications
The DF5A5.6CFU features a reverse standoff voltage of 5.6V. Its design is optimized for handling ESD events, as specified by industry standards. The clamping voltage is kept low to ensure that protected circuits are not exposed to harmful voltage levels during transient events. It is supplied in a small surface-mount package (e.g., SOD-962) for easy and automated assembly. The operating temperature range is typically -40°C to +85°C. This diode can withstand repeated ESD strikes without any significant performance degradation.
